Extraction Of Dibenzothiophene From N-Dodecane Using Ionic Liquids, M. Zulhaziman M. Salleh
Zulhaziman Salleh
Deep desulfurization of fuels has attracted lot of attention from growing number of researchers due to more stringent regulations imposed on sulfur content. There is a great demand to comply the regulation in current technology (hydrodesulfurization) because it requires high pressure, high temperature and high hydrogen consumption. Furthermore, aromatic sulfur compounds are also inefficient to be removed in current technology. Ionic Liquids (ILs) as class of green solvent actually plays important role as a promising alternative for desulfurization of fuels. A Comparative Study Of Biopolymers And Alum In The Separation And Recovery Of Pulp Fibres From Paper Mill Effluent By Flocculation, Sumona Mukherjee Ms, Soumyadeep Mukhopadhyay Dr, Agamuthu Pariatamby Dr, Mohd Ali Hashim Dr, Jaya N. Sahu Dr, Bhaskar Sen Gupta Dr
Soumyadeep Mukhopadhyay Dr
Recovery of cellulose fibres from paper mill effluent has been studied using common polysaccharides or biopolymers such as Guar gum, Xanthan gum and Locust bean gum as flocculent. Guar gum is commonly used in sizing paper and routinely used in paper making. The results have been compared with the performance of alum, which is a common coagulant and a key ingredient of the paper industry. Guar gum recovered about 3.86 mg/L of fibre and was most effective among the biopolymers. Effects Of Wetting Agents And Approaching Anode On Lead Migration In Electrokinetic Soil Remediation, Yee Sern Ng, Bhaskar Sen Gupta, Mohd Ali Hashim
Ng Yee-Sern
Approaching anode is one of the enhancement techniques in electrokinetic soil remediation. This technique is reported to give promising migration for heavy metals under shorter treatment time and at lower cost in comparison to normal fixed anode system. In the present study, the effectiveness of fixed anode and approaching anode techniques in electrokinetic soil remediation for lead migration under different types of wetting agents (0.01M NaNO3 and 0.1M citric acid) was investigated. Performance Evaluation Of Two-Stage Electrokinetic Washing As Soil Remediation Method For Lead Removal Using Different Wash Solutions, Yee Sern Ng, Bhaskar Sen Gupta, Mohd Ali Hashim
Ng Yee-Sern
The study explores the application of a two-stage electrokinetic washing system on remediation of lead (Pb) contaminated soil. The process involved an initial soil washing, followed by an electrokinetic process. The use of electrokinetic process in soil washing not only provided additional driving force for transporting the desorbed Pb away from the soil but also reduced the high usage of wash solution. In this study, the effect of NaNO3, HNO3, citric acid and EDTA as wash solutions on two-stage electrokinetic washing system were evaluated.
